Transaction 72176627cf51ded66871171ce140ecabeb381b89c1d4946e69ae08b68e2a0e9c

1 Input
2 Outputs
  • 72176627cf51ded66871171ce140ecabeb381b89c1d4946e69ae08b68e2a0e9c:0
  • value  209502
    address  3Dpg1dsX2eqaDhnphf5fKdx7YHSqKPPWQ9
  • 72176627cf51ded66871171ce140ecabeb381b89c1d4946e69ae08b68e2a0e9c:1
  • value  4780508
    address  bc1qqhlqaunnfwwa89hda4046wxggkjfmdn7uldnqv